Career Corner: Ask a Recruiter
|
Where do I find job postings?
|
|
|
One of the most mysterious aspects of landing a new job is knowing where to find them. Not all recruiting budgets or strategies are created equally, therefore, organizations employ various approaches to posting openings. Unless you have 1-3 target employers and you’re frequently scanning their career pages, looking for aligned job postings takes some work.
Organizations with robust recruiting budgets will likely post in multiple places, including their website, a variety of job boards (industry specific, executive search firms, general job boards), social media sites, and in-person/virtual job-fairs. Organizations with smaller budgets will likely limit their postings to their website, and social media (and websites like indeed, which aggregate jobs from other job boards, may post the roles too, but not within the first pages of a search).
Here are some strategies for finding job postings:
- Create a list of target job titles you can easily reference before you start searching. For example, a seasoned nonprofit professional skilled in Talent and Strategy might search for “Chief of Staff” or “Director of Talent Initiatives” or “Special Project Director” or “Vice President of Human Resources” or “Director of People Operations” and so much more!
- Draft a list of target employers and follow them on LinkedIn, sign up for career notifications on their website (if they have that feature available), and check out their website career pages.
- Visit TrulyHired, WorkTogether Talent Consulting’s FREE education job board!
- Compile a list of search firms specializing in your target industry, like WorkTogether Talent Consulting, and visit their websites - you may uncover roles not yet posted on company websites (with employer names removed).
- Visit your social media sites of choice and search for hashtags like #edtechjobs or #hiring and #education.
- Check out sites like Indeed, but know that you’ll likely be scrolling for a while before finding aligned positions (because of the nature of how the website functions - sponsored jobs and aggregating other job boards).
- Connect with recruiters and/or hiring managers at your target employers and simply ask if they are currently hiring for or planning to hire for your job function (get as specific as possible - instead of “are you hiring for anything right now?” try, “are you hiring for any people operations/talent development roles now or in the near future?”).
- Ask your network - are they aware of current roles aligned to your skills/interests, or anticipate openings in the near future?
